Noun



  1. A physical object whose shape is used as a guide to make other objects
  2. A generic model or pattern from which other objects are based or derived
  3. A macromolecule which provides a pattern for the synthesis of another molecule

    • Verb



      1. To set up or mark off using a template
          1. To provide a template or pattern for
